Carol Tomaszewski
The outside looks a little scary-and the entrance is in the back. So you may be tempted to not go in. But, the inside is inviting and the food is delicious! Our server was great, she was so friendly and helpful. We ordered 2 steaks, calamari, and soup. The steaks were cooked perfectly, and the steak sauce flight we got was also delicious. Would recommend to friends for sure.

Brenda Bartlett
Everything was fabulous–the atmosphere, the service, and especially the food! I went with a party of 7, and had the opportunity to sample several different dishes. Every single one was unique and divine! The sauces and seasonings made all the difference. I especially loved the scallops, the popover “dinner rolls,” the southern salad, and coconut cake; not to mention, my steak, which was so tender and prepared to perfection. The sides that i tasted were also excellent; only the asparagus was kind of ordinary, still good but not as unique in flavor as the other dishes. Overall, G.O.L. provided an exquisite dining experience!

Russel Todd
At first we were a little hesitant when we walked in, as not many people were there. However we ended up enjoying an EXCELLENT meal from start to finish. We had the cheese platter and scallop shooters. The shooters have a hint of spice but finished nicely with lime. The steaks were all cooked perfectly and amongst, if not the best in the Lehigh Valley. In addition the lobster tail was also excellent and certainly the best and largest around! Finally the desserts were awesome, but the two best were the chocolate cake and smores brownie. Only negative is the place doesn’t have a bar, but feel free to bring your own or enjoy a house complimentary!!!!

Jeremy Beeler
We were excited to try a new restaurant, so we made a reservation. When we arrived there were 3 other parties dining. First we were served popovers, which were good but cold. Then we got a cheese plate, which was good. Then we got our salad and asked for more water as our glasses had been empty for some time. The waitress said she would bring some but did. Meanwhile, customers from another table sat down at a piano to play and sing like we were at an open mic night. The staff seemed to encourage it. Two parties then left, so it was just us and one other couple. The waitress went to the other table to ask about desserts, then went to the back to grind coffee and deliver their desserts. In both trips she avoided eye contact with us, leaving empty salad plates and empty water glasses on our table. By this point, it had been more than an hour since we arrived and more than 20 minutes since she served our salads and we asked for more water. Not once did she check on us or acknowledge us that whole time. When she finally came back, it was with our entrees and still no water. My mushroom enchiladas were served in a glass meatloaf dish. At this point we said to take the food back because we were unhappy with the wait and poor service. The manager then came out with our sides and we repeated our concern. He asked if she had brought our check and we said no. He apologized, but never offered to take anything off our bill. Instead, they packed all the food up and charged us full price for a dinner that we will never eat. I should have refused to pay, but instead gave the gift card I had brought to pay. After several minutes of waiting, they told me the gift card a ould not go through and I had to use another card. In the end, I paid way too much money that I never intended to spend on anything other than a gift card for a long time sitting and being ignored and for a meal I will never eat. I would never go back and I would caution anyone else to avoid this restaurant. Poor service, poorly managed kitchen, and an attempt to be upscale with gaudy decorations and a karaoke bar atmosphere. You would be better off going somewhere else.
